加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0l.com.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ux下快速搭建稳定数据库,赋能高并发项目

发布时间:2026-06-13 13:12:07 所属栏目:Linux 来源:DaWei
导读:  在高并发项目中,数据库的性能与稳定性直接决定系统整体表现。选择一个适合的数据库并快速部署,是开发团队的核心任务之一。Linux系统因其开源、高效和广泛支持,成为部署数据库的理想环境。  推荐使用MySQL或

  在高并发项目中,数据库的性能与稳定性直接决定系统整体表现。选择一个适合的数据库并快速部署,是开发团队的核心任务之一。Linux系统因其开源、高效和广泛支持,成为部署数据库的理想环境。


  推荐使用MySQL或MariaDB作为关系型数据库,它们兼容性好、社区活跃,且对高并发场景有良好优化。以Ubuntu为例,通过apt命令可快速安装:sudo apt update && sudo apt install mysql-server。安装完成后,运行sudo mysql_secure_installation进行安全配置,设置root密码并移除匿名用户。


  为提升数据库性能,需合理调整配置文件。编辑/etc/mysql/mysql.conf.d/mysqld.cnf,适当增加innodb_buffer_pool_size(建议设为物理内存的70%),开启慢查询日志并启用连接池管理,减少频繁建立连接的开销。


  借助systemd管理数据库服务,确保开机自启与异常自动恢复。使用sudo systemctl enable mysql,让服务随系统启动;通过sudo systemctl status mysql实时监控状态,及时发现异常。


2026AI模拟图,仅供参考

  对于读写分离需求,可引入主从复制架构。主库负责写入,多个从库分担读请求,有效缓解单一节点压力。通过配置my.cnf中的server-id、log-bin等参数,结合CHANGE MASTER TO指令完成同步设置。


  若项目需要更高扩展性,可考虑使用Redis作为缓存层,减轻数据库负载。配合Nginx反向代理,实现动静分离,进一步提升响应速度。


  整个过程可在30分钟内完成,兼顾稳定性与性能。只要合理规划、持续监控,即可为高并发项目提供坚实的数据支撑,真正实现“快速搭建、稳定运行”。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章